What is an off page SEO course?
An off page SEO course is a learning program that focuses on everything you do outside your website to improve its visibility on search engines. That includes link building, brand mentions, social sharing, influencer outreach, and digital PR.

What a High-Quality Off Page SEO Course Should Cover
When I review SEO courses (and I do, often), I always check for five key things. First, the course must go deep on link building strategies — not just “get backlinks,” but how to do outreach, how to pitch content, and how to avoid spammy links.
Second, I want to see real tool walkthroughs — Ahrefs, SEMrush, Moz, Google Search Console — because these tools are essential to the job. Third, any solid course should explain brand signals — how to increase your visibility on the web through mentions, reviews, and citations.
Fourth, they need to include competitive backlink analysis so you can find gaps and link-building opportunities. Lastly, the course should teach reporting and KPIs — knowing how to measure if your off-page efforts are actually working.
Keeping It Real: How to Know if a Course Follows Google’s Rules
I’ll be honest — some SEO courses out there still promote shady stuff: buying links, using link farms, or automated outreach spam. That’s a fast track to a Google penalty.
A reputable off page SEO course will align with white-hat SEO practices. Look for instructors with real-world SEO experience and partnerships with respected brands.
The content should include Google’s latest algorithm considerations, like E-E-A-T (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ness). If a course doesn’t talk about these standards, it’s outdated.

Free vs. Paid Off Page SEO Courses: What’s the Real Difference?
I’ve taken both. Free courses like those from HubSpot and Semrush are great for getting started.
They’ll teach you the basics of backlinks, outreach, and tools. But when you’re working with clients — or managing serious SEO campaigns — you’ll hit a ceiling.
That’s when paid courses shine. You’ll get access to expert feedback, templates, live Q&As, and deeper strategies.
For instance, courses from the American Marketing Association or advanced Udemy programs go into granular detail. Here’s a quick breakdown:
Feature | Free Courses | Paid Courses |
Cost | $0 | $79–$650 |
Depth | Basic concepts | Intermediate–Advanced |
Access to Experts | Limited | Often included |
Tools Covered | Few | Many |
Support | Forums only | Live or direct |
If you’re just dipping your toes in, start with free. But if you’re aiming to lead SEO efforts professionally, invest in something premium.

How to Apply What You Learn to Real-World SEO Work
Every time I take a new course, I test what I learn on our own blog first. I recommend the same.
Try your outreach templates, test different content formats, use tools to analyze backlink profiles. Then move on to client work with data-driven confidence.
Use platforms like HARO to respond to journalists. Create infographics or guides that earn links naturally.
Build your SEO reports to show traffic increases, referral domain growth, and link acquisition rates. These are things you can’t fake — and they matter to clients.
